BBC Studios Joins Reality+ To Unleash Metaverse Experiences

BBC Studios has partnered with Reality+ to develop metaverse experiences in The Sandbox, enabling the fans to interact with immersive content from famous brands like Doctor Who and Top Gear. The venture has marked BBC’s entry into the metaverse and adopts the concept of constantly shared digital space.

BBC Studios Dives Into The Metaverse

The new partnership with Reality+ enables BBC Studios to create a presence in the metaverse providing a home for the fans to engage with their favorite brands within a virtual space. The Sandbox offers the platform for the immersive experience, enabling users to build, own, and monetize all their virtual experiences on the blockchain.

With more than 400 entertainment brands already active in The Sandbox, including Ubisoft, Warner Music Group, and Gucci Vault, BBC Studios now joins an ever-growing community of industry leaders that are exploring the potential that comes with the metaverse. This community growth highlights the importance of the metaverse as a future entertainment medium.

BBC Studios Has Ambitious Plans

The President Brands & Licensing at BBC Studios, Nicki Sheard, insists that the project’s role in the firm’s widespread strategy to expand brands into many new categories. This integration of innovative technology and platforms is an integral component of BBC Studio’s ambitious plans for audience engagement and growth.

Co-founder of Reality+, Tony Pearce, expressed his excitement about pushing boundaries of the metaverse and creating worthwhile experiences for fans of popular TV shows. The successful partnership on the digital trading card game Doctor Who: Worlds Apart sets the center stage for more exciting ventures coming up in The Sandbox.

Leveraging Top-Notch Technology

COO and Co-founder at The Sandbox, Sebastien Borget, recognizes the BBC’s history of leveraging high-quality and advanced technology for mainstream entertainment. The partnership strives to introduce the British culture and fans into the virtual spaces, notably expanding the influence and reach of the BBC’s content.

BBC Studios’ venture into the metaverse via its partnership with Reality+ and The Sandbox indicates that there is a growing importance of immersive digital experiences. As the metaverse continues with its evolution, the BBC’s presence in this space opens up some new possibilities for user engagement and deep cultural exploration.

BBC Studios plans to launch its metaverse space in The Sandbox later this year.
